The World : Car Bomb Kills U.S. Aide

An American defense attache assigned to the U.S. Embassy in Athens was killed by a bomb near his home today, a Pentagon spokesman said. The attache, a Navy captain who was identified by police in the Greek capital as William Nordine, had just left his home in the wealthy north Athens suburb of Kefalari when the blast occurred. The bomb had been placed in another car parked about 100 yards from Nordine’s home and appeared to have been detonated by remote control as he drove by, police added. There was no immediate claim of responsibility.
